Product details

The Schneider Electric LC3F400E7 is a pre-wired TeSys F star delta starter, built as a complete three-contactor assembly for reduced-voltage starting of three-phase induction motors. Motor power capability spans 185 kW at 220/230 V AC up to 375 kW at 440 V AC, all at 50/60 Hz. The control circuit is 48 V AC 50/60 Hz, with an inrush of 1075 VA at cos phi 0.9.

Rated breaking capacity is 3200 A and rated making capacity is 4000 A, both conforming to IEC 60947-4-1 — these numbers tell you the starter can safely interrupt a locked-rotor fault and close onto a starting inrush without welding contacts. Mechanical durability is 10 million cycles, so it is built for high-cycle applications like conveyors or pumps that cycle frequently.

This is a plate-mounted assembly, not a DIN-rail snap-on. The footprint is substantial: 28.5 inches wide by 10.9 inches deep by 7.09 inches tall, so panel layout needs to account for the width and the M10 bolted power connections. Power circuit terminals accept bar or lug-ring terminations up to 150 mm². The front face carries IP20 protection with shrouds per IEC 60529 and VDE 0106, meaning finger-safe from the front once shrouded, but the back and sides are open to the enclosure.

Auxiliary contacts and control wiring

The built-in auxiliary contact configuration is specific to star-delta sequencing: the KM1 star contactor carries 1 NC + 1 NO, KM2 line contactor carries 2 NC + 1 NO, and KM3 delta contactor carries 1 NC + 2 NO. That is a total of 4 NC and 4 NO built in — enough for most interlocking and status feedback without adding external aux blocks. Control circuit wiring uses screw clamp terminals accepting 1 to 4 mm² flexible or solid wire, torqued to 1.2 N·m. The power circuit bolted connections require 35 N·m.

Frequently asked questions

What are the key motor power ratings for the LC3F400E7?

Motor power is rated at 185 kW on 220/230 V AC, 315 kW on 380/400 V AC, 355 kW on 415 V AC, and 375 kW on 440 V AC, all at 50/60 Hz in AC-3 duty.

What control voltage does the LC3F400E7 require?

The control circuit is 48 V AC 50/60 Hz. Operational limits are 0.85 to 1.1 times Uc at 40-400 Hz, with dropout between 0.35 and 0.55 Uc.

What are the physical dimensions of the LC3F400E7?

Width is 28.5 inches (725 mm), depth is 10.9 inches (276 mm), and height is 7.09 inches (180 mm). It is designed for plate mounting.

What standards does the LC3F400E7 comply with?

It complies with IEC 60947-4-1, EN 60947-4-1, JIS C8201-4-1, IEC 60947-1, and EN 60947-1. Front-face protection is IP20 with shrouds per IEC 60529 and VDE 0106.
